Chronicle of an hour and a half. - A review

There is a new voice emerging from the South Indian literature space that needs to be listened to. Like the rain, in his debut novel ' Chronicle of an hour and a half', Shaharu Nusaiba Kannanari relentlessly pours out a story with conviction of a heavy rainfall that makes anyone to stop dead on their tracks. His narration is solid, his prose flows with such poignance that it creates extraordinary visual images that last long after reading it. The philosophy that he carries through his characters shatters the conventional storytelling. 'Chronicle of an hour and half ' is a must read; Shahuru's voice demands to be heard.

Dude review and what its takes to be a hero in 2K25

  Dude is unconventional; this movie deals with subjects that may offend the larger audience. But here is the highlight: it's not a ‘cuckhold movie’ or any other derogatory term could not be tagged to this movie. After its initial release, this movie got bashed left and right for portraying a love triangle most unconventionally; this initial response made me reluctant to go watch it. But after its OTT release, I thought I could give it a try, and not going to lie, I enjoyed every bit of this movie. Although the first 10 minutes of the movie were too chaotic for me to handle, and with the unpleasant mix of oorum blood song, the chaos was unbearable. I almost went to switch it off, as there was a predetermined opinion about this movie that exists within me from all the online responses. But I am very much glad that I watched it, and I loved it.
